Short note on Simon commission. |
|
Answer» Answer: The Simon Commission was a group of 7 MPs from Britain who were SENT to India in 1928 to study CONSTITUTIONAL reforms and make recommendations to the government. The Commission was ORIGINALLY NAMED the Indian Statutory Commission. It came to be known as the Simon Commission after its chairman Sir John Simon. |

What made Gandhi call of th non cooperation movement |
|
Answer» Answer: After an angry mob murdered police officers in the village of Chauri Chaura (now in Uttar Pradesh state) in February 1922, Gandhi himself called off the movement; the next MONTH he was arrested WITHOUT INCIDENT. Difference between Western Ghats and Eastern Ghats..? |
|
Answer» Answer: The eastern ghats RUN parallel to the eastern coastal plains of India. Unlike the western ghats, they are discontinuous in nature and is DISSECTED by the rivers that drain into the BAY of BENGAL. ... It must be noted that the eastern ghats are lower in elevation than the western ghats. |

Distinguish between inner core and the outer core. |
|
Answer» Answer: The inner core and the outer core are MADE up of similar stuff chemically (both are made mostly of IRON, with a little nickel and some other chemical ELEMENTS)--the difference between them is that the outer core is liquid and the inner core is solid. please do follow |

Why were temple built in bengal in points short answer |
|
Answer» Answer: Temples were BUILT in Bengal by some individuals or groups to house the local deities and also to demonstrate their POWER and RICHNESS. As the European TRADING companies introduced many new economic opportunities inBengal, it improved the social and economic STATUS of many families. |
